A series of nine bis(arylimino)pyridine iron complexes containing halogen or alkynyl substituents in their ligand frameworks was synthesized and characterized. After activation with methylalumoxane (MAO), these catalysts oligomerize or polymerize ethylene to give highly linear products. The introduction of halogen or alkynyl substituents in the para-position of the iminophenyl rings has a great influence on the polymerization activities of the corresponding iron complexes.
